· The SMD2920 Series, a polymer-based Positive Temperature Coefficient (PTC) device to protect electrical circuits against overcurrent conditions with resettable feature, is fully compatible with current industrial standards.
· The new designed SMD2920 Series provides surface mount overcurrent protection with superior performance.
· Application: The SMD2920 Series is ideal for computers and peripherals and can be applied to almost anywhere there is a low voltage power supply and a load to be protected.
· The solder plated termination is designed to meet or exceed solderability specifications and provide excellent solder joint inspectability.
· Agency Approval: UL File # E201431. CSA File # CA115375-1

The environmental specifications of the SMD2920 can be summarized as:(1)operating/storage temperature:-40 to +85;(2)maximum device surface
temperature in tripped state:125;(3)passive aging:+85,1000 hours(±5% typical resistance change);(4)humidity aging:+85,85%R.H.1000 hours(±5% typical resistance change);(5)thermal shock:MIL-STD-202 method 107G +85/-40 20 times(-30% typical resistance change) and (6)solvent resistance:MIL-STD-202,method 215 (no change).
